About the Company

OTI Lumionics specializes in the design and creation of cutting-edge materials using quantum simulations, machine learning, and practical testing in pilot production environments. Their current focus includes developing critical materials for OLED displays aimed at next-generation consumer electronics and automotive markets. The company pioneers advanced electrode materials and manufacturing technologies to create transparent displays and lighting solutions. Collaborating closely with customers and partners, they design materials optimized for mass production, leveraging their computational Materials Discovery Platform to accelerate material innovation and meet client demands swiftly.

Key Responsibilities

  • Execute laboratory analyses of raw materials, in-process samples, and finished products following established methods, utilizing instruments such as NMR, Mass Spectrometry, HPLC, UV, IR, TGA, and DSC.
  • Support the development, transfer, and validation of analytical methods.
  • Contribute to troubleshooting issues related to methods and instrumentation.
  • Accurately document all testing procedures, deviations, and findings in strict compliance with standard operating procedures (SOPs).
  • Maintain a safe, well-organized laboratory environment adhering to health, safety, and environmental standards.
  • Comply with environmental policies and actively engage in minimizing environmental impact relevant to the role.
  • Follow health and safety protocols, promptly report hazards, and help sustain a safe workplace for all personnel.
  • Perform additional duties as assigned.

Candidate Profile and Skills

  • Possess a Master’s or Doctoral degree in Chemistry or a closely related scientific discipline.
  • Solid understanding of fundamental chemistry concepts, including chromatography and spectroscopic instrumentation.
  • Familiarity with organic chemistry is advantageous.
  • Proficient with Microsoft Office applications (Word, Excel, PowerPoint) and data analysis software.
  • Knowledge of Good Manufacturing Practice (GMP) and Good Laboratory Practice (GLP) standards is a plus.
  • Strong verbal and written communication abilities.
  • High attention to detail, with a capacity for quick learning, flexibility, initiative, and a proactive attitude.
